The Inland Empire Utilities Agency is soliciting bids for the Construction of RP-5 Offsite Facilities Project EN19001.03 and Butterfield Lift Station Improvements Project EN26054 in California. This contract encompasses the provision of all materials, labor, equipment, and facilities required to install, commission, and deliver a fully functional project. The primary scope of work is divided into four major components: the Butterfield Dual Force Main, the Mountain Avenue Lift Station, the RP-2 Lift Station, and the Butterfield Lift Station. This opportunity is open to various small business designations, including Small Disadvantaged Businesses, Women-Owned Small Businesses, HUBZone Small Businesses, and Veteran-Owned Small Businesses. The solicitation was posted on September 12, 2026, with a response deadline of October 6, 2026. Interested parties should coordinate with the primary point of contact, Jordan Villalobos, regarding the requirements for this NAICS 237110 classified project.

Harbel, Inc. is seeking MBE, DBE, and WBE subcontractors and suppliers for a targeted green-street retrofit project in downtown Romney, West Virginia. The project involves the construction of approximately 343.59 linear feet of South Marsham Street between Gravel Lane and US Route 50. The scope of work includes the installation of 1,450 square feet of permeable pavement, eight vegetated stormwater management cells, and necessary drainage, underdrain, inlet, pipe, tie-in, and downspout work. Additionally, the project requires limited curb, sidewalk, ADA, apron, crossing, and traffic-calming improvements to integrate the BMP corridor, as well as the planting of six native trees and approximately 345 native plants. The goal is to treat approximately 1.7 acres of impervious surface within a 3.3-acre drainage area, concluding with final stabilization, cleanup, and restoration. This solicitation is open to various small business concerns, including veteran-owned, service-disabled veteran-owned, HUBZone, disadvantaged, woman-owned, and minority-owned businesses. To accommodate the project scale, these entities are encouraged to form consortiums if individual bid items are too large for a single firm to handle. Bids must be submitted by September 17, 2026, at 4:00 P.M. Interested parties should contact Jonah Leith or Jennifer Wilson for further details and must provide a response indicating their intent to bid.

The Inland Feeder/SBVMWD Foothill PS Intertie, Stage 1 project, located in Highland, California, is a comprehensive infrastructure initiative issued by the Metropolitan Water District of Southern California through James W. Fowler Co. The scope of work involves the furnishing and installation of approximately 2,150 linear feet of 54-inch to 66-inch diameter steel pipe and 200 linear feet of 144-inch diameter steel pipe. The project includes the installation of both contractor-furnished and Metropolitan-furnished valves ranging from 54 to 132 inches in diameter, as well as 54-inch and 145.5-inch diameter tie-ins and associated pipe fittings. Additional construction requirements include the delivery of four surge tanks, two valve vaults, an air compressor yard structure, and various drainage improvements. The technical scope extends to electrical upgrades, instrumentation and controls, piping systems, welding, disinfection, and surface restoration, alongside the excavation of cobbles and large boulders. This solicitation, posted on September 11, 2026, with a response deadline of September 29, 2026, is open to small businesses, including certified service-disabled veteran-owned, minority, and women-owned enterprises. The prime contractor, J.W. Fowler, is actively seeking subcontractor pricing and offering support to M/W/DBE firms regarding bonding, insurance, and equipment procurement to maximize participation.

Inland Empire Utilities Agency Chino Basin ProgramThe Inland Empire Utilities Agency Chino Basin Program is a conjunctive use water project funded by a 269 million dollar conditional award from the Proposition 1 Water Storage Investment Program. The program is designed to utilize advanced water purification to treat and store up to 15,000 acre-feet-per-year of new water supply over a 25-year period. This supply facilitates a State exchange where water is provided in blocks of up to 50,000 acre-feet-per-year during dry years to enable pulse flows in the Feather River, improving habitat conditions for native salmonids and other fish species. The project is administered through agreements with the California Department of Water Resources, the California Department of Fish and Wildlife, and the Metropolitan Water District. The program involves the development of an advanced water purification facility, new injection and extraction wells, and conveyance infrastructure primarily located in the northern portion of the Chino Basin, north of the Interstate 10 Freeway. During the initial 25-year exchange commitment, locally produced water will replace imported supplies. Following this period, the facilities will remain operationally viable to provide a permanent local water supply for the agency. The project has undergone extensive environmental review, including a Recirculated Final PEIR and a 2024 Pulse Flows Component FSEIR, and has filed Notices of Determination in San Bernardino, Riverside, and Los Angeles counties to ensure compliance with the California Environmental Quality Act and Public Resources Code.
